Impact Statement Shelter Movers is a national, volunteer-powered charitable organization providing moving and storage services at no cost to individuals and families fleeing abuse. We collaborate with local businesses and community agencies to support people, primarily women and children, as they transition to a life free of violence.
Description The Move Coordinator corresponds with the client, ensures volunteer teams are prepared, and that the move goes smoothly, including responding to and problem-solving unforeseen challenges on the day of the move.

- Communicate with the Move Coordination Supervisor(s)to recruit an appropriate team of volunteers
- Coordinate move logistics, including (but not limited to) vehicle reservations, storage arrangements, and scheduling of private security or police
- Create a customized itinerary for the move (using a provided template)
- Be 'on call' throughout the duration of the move to support the Lead Mover with any unexpected challenges
- Report back to the Move Coordination Supervisor(s) after each move to debrief
- Have regular check-ins with your Move Coordination Supervisor(s)
- Follow the processes and procedures detailed in the Move Coordination Manual
- Attend regular Intake Team meetings as instructed by the Move Coordination Supervisor(s).
Training Details You’ll receive training in preparation for your role, and have access to ongoing training opportunities.
Working Conditions Approximately 3-4 hours of planning and 4-5 hours of ‘on-call’ availability per move. The expectation is to coordinate a minimum of 1 move per month. The first few moves will of course take longer to plan as you are getting used to the process.

*Please note: the work of a Move Coordinator isn’t performed in a single or continuous ‘shift’; rather, it involves communication with the client over the phone and planning at your convenience. Typically this planning stage spans approximately 7 to 10 days prior to the move. Then, on the day of the move we ask you to be ‘on-call’, or available and reachable by phone should any issues arise during the move.

This is a fully remote position, with occasional meetings (in-person and/or conference calls.)
